use libc::c_void;
use base::{CFIndex, CFAllocatorRef, CFTypeID};
pub type CFArrayRetainCallBack = *const u8;
pub type CFArrayReleaseCallBack = *const u8;
pub type CFArrayCopyDescriptionCallBack = *const u8;
pub type CFArrayEqualCallBack = *const u8;
#[repr(C)]
#[derive(Clone, Copy)]
pub struct CFArrayCallBacks {
pub version: CFIndex,
pub retain: CFArrayRetainCallBack,
pub release: CFArrayReleaseCallBack,
pub copyDescription: CFArrayCopyDescriptionCallBack,
pub equal: CFArrayEqualCallBack,
}
#[repr(C)]
pub struct __CFArray(c_void);
pub type CFArrayRef = *const __CFArray;
extern {
pub static kCFTypeArrayCallBacks: CFArrayCallBacks;
pub fn CFArrayCreate(allocator: CFAllocatorRef, values: *const *const c_void,
numValues: CFIndex, callBacks: *const CFArrayCallBacks) -> CFArrayRef;
pub fn CFArrayGetCount(theArray: CFArrayRef) -> CFIndex;
pub fn CFArrayGetValueAtIndex(theArray: CFArrayRef, idx: CFIndex) -> *const c_void;
pub fn CFArrayGetTypeID() -> CFTypeID;
}
